Isabel Weaving is pining for her second husband, the charismatic Max, but he is no longer around. She adores her beloved granddaughter, Sophie, and her distant son, Dominic. But she views the rest of her family (placid daughter, Kate, mild-mannered first husband, Steve, bossy big sister, Zoe) with withering distaste.

Cooee is Vivienne Kelly’s debut novel, originally published in 2008—a story full of wit, dark humour and unexpected twists and turns.

Vivienne Kelly was born and educated in Melbourne, where she now lives. She has worked at the University of Melbourne and at Monash University, and was awarded a doctorate for her work on myth and history in Australia. Cooee, her first novel was shortlisted for the Age Book of the Year Awards. Her second book, the heartwarming, darkly funny family novel The Starlings, will be published in 2017.
